Notes

  • F-Beat XX5 contained "Pay no more than 50p" notice on sleeve.
  • The first 1,500 picture discs came with a black rim (promo copies) and are currently worth about twice as much as the later clear rimmed copies (15000 pressed). Some brown rimmed copies were also released.
  • On the US white label promo, the runout on one side is the number ZSS 167275-1C T and the '5' is scratched over to a '6'. On the other side is ZSS 167275-1C T and the entire number portion is scratched out and '167675' is scratched in lightly to the side.
